The Witcher Season 2 continues its triumphant run on Netflix since its premiere last December. The hit fantasy series is an adaptation of Polish author Andrzej Sapkowski’s series of novels and short stories. As well as the popular video games developed by CD Projekt Red. As the first English TV adaptation of the franchise, The Witcher has earned a huge army of devoted fans. And they more than look forward to all sorts of content falling under The Witcher universe. 

Even before the network released the second installment, Netflix greenlit the franchise for a third season. Although, there confirms regarding the actual start of the shoot. As per the report published on January 6, the filming was supposed to begin this month. But as of now, there is nothing that suggests the same. Be that as it would, the network might start filming soon enough.

To add to the anticipation, The Witcher showrunner Lauren Schmidt Hissrich recently revealed how the third season will be “huge”. An invested Witcher fan recently got on Twitter and asked Hissrich about the expanse of the budget for Season 3 in correlation to the other seasons. In response, Hissrich cleverly maneuvered the conversation towards teasing the season and revealed how it would be “huge”. Which is still not a lot to go on with. 

However, based on our speculations, this is what we figure. Hissrich’s sneak peek might point towards the third season’s greater objectives. And this is probably with respect to the overall scale of production. That said, nothing is official as of yet.
